1. What Exactly Is Atmospheric Pressure?

Atmospheric pressure, also known as barometric pressure, is simply the weight of the air above us. Picture the Earth as a big beach ball surrounded by a sea of air. The air isn’t just floating around; it has mass, and mass means weight. This weight presses down on the Earth’s surface, creating what we call atmospheric pressure. And guess what? It’s not constant—it fluctuates, which is why we have changing weather. 🌋🌀

2. High Pressure Systems: The Calm Before the Storm?

High pressure systems are like the quiet, sunny days when everything feels just right. These systems bring clear skies, mild temperatures, and calm winds. In a high-pressure area, the air sinks and warms, which inhibits cloud formation and keeps the weather stable. Think of it as the Earth’s version of a spa day—relaxing and serene. However, too much of a good thing can lead to droughts, so balance is key! ☀️💦

3. Low Pressure Systems: When the Sky Decides to Cry

Low pressure systems, on the other hand, are the drama queens of the atmosphere. They’re responsible for those stormy, rainy days when you just want to stay inside with a cup of hot cocoa. In low-pressure areas, warm air rises, cools, and condenses, forming clouds and precipitation. These systems often bring strong winds, heavy rain, and sometimes even thunderstorms. It’s like the sky is having a hissy fit! 💧⚡

4. How Atmospheric Pressure Affects Us Everyday

Atmospheric pressure doesn’t just dictate the weather; it impacts our bodies and even our moods. Have you ever felt a headache coming on before a storm? That’s often due to a drop in barometric pressure. People with arthritis or joint pain might notice their symptoms worsening during low-pressure periods. On the flip side, some folks swear they feel more energetic and upbeat under high pressure. So, next time you’re feeling a bit off, check the weather report—it might just be the pressure talking! 😷💪
